76 (defvar gnus-select-method
78 (list 'nntp (or (condition-case ()
79 (gnus-getenv-nntpserver)
81 (if (and gnus-default-nntp-server
82 (not (string= gnus-default-nntp-server "")))
83 gnus-default-nntp-server)
85 (if (or (null gnus-nntp-service)
86 (equal gnus-nntp-service "nntp"))
88 (list gnus-nntp-service)))
89 "*Default method for selecting a newsgroup.
90 This variable should be a list, where the first element is how the
91 news is to be fetched, the second is the address.
93 For instance, if you want to get your news via NNTP from
94 \"flab.flab.edu\", you could say:
96 (setq gnus-select-method '(nntp \"flab.flab.edu\"))
98 If you want to use your local spool, say:
100 (setq gnus-select-method (list 'nnspool (system-name)))
102 If you use this variable, you must set `gnus-nntp-server' to nil.
104 There is a lot more to know about select methods and virtual servers -
105 see the manual for details.")

122 (defvar gnus-message-archive-group nil
123 "*Name of the group in which to save the messages you've written.
124 This can either be a string, a list of strings; or an alist
125 of regexps/functions/forms to be evaluated to return a string (or a list
126 of strings). The functions are called with the name of the current
127 group (or nil) as a parameter.
129 If you want to save your mail in one group and the news articles you
130 write in another group, you could say something like:
132 \(setq gnus-message-archive-group
133 '((if (message-news-p)
137 Normally the group names returned by this variable should be
138 unprefixed -- which implictly means \"store on the archive server\".
139 However, you may wish to store the message on some other server. In
140 that case, just return a fully prefixed name of the group --
141 \"nnml+private:mail.misc\", for instance.")

718 (defvar gnus-summary-line-format "%U\%R\%z\%I\%(%[%4L: %-20,20n%]%) %s\n"
719 "*The format specification of the lines in the summary buffer.
721 It works along the same lines as a normal formatting string,
722 with some simple extensions.
724 %N Article number, left padded with spaces (string)
726 %s Subject if it is at the root of a thread, and \"\" otherwise (string)
727 %n Name of the poster (string)
728 %a Extracted name of the poster (string)
729 %A Extracted address of the poster (string)
730 %F Contents of the From: header (string)
731 %x Contents of the Xref: header (string)
732 %D Date of the article (string)
733 %d Date of the article (string) in DD-MMM format
734 %M Message-id of the article (string)
735 %r References of the article (string)
736 %c Number of characters in the article (integer)
737 %L Number of lines in the article (integer)
738 %I Indentation based on thread level (a string of spaces)
739 %T A string with two possible values: 80 spaces if the article
740 is on thread level two or larger and 0 spaces on level one
741 %R \"A\" if this article has been replied to, \" \" otherwise (character)
742 %U Status of this article (character, \"R\", \"K\", \"-\" or \" \")
743 %[ Opening bracket (character, \"[\" or \"<\")
744 %] Closing bracket (character, \"]\" or \">\")
745 %> Spaces of length thread-level (string)
746 %< Spaces of length (- 20 thread-level) (string)
747 %i Article score (number)
748 %z Article zcore (character)
749 %t Number of articles under the current thread (number).
750 %e Whether the thread is empty or not (character).
751 %l GroupLens score (string).
752 %P The line number (number).
753 %u User defined specifier. The next character in the format string should
754 be a letter. Gnus will call the function gnus-user-format-function-X,
755 where X is the letter following %u. The function will be passed the
756 current header as argument. The function should return a string, which
757 will be inserted into the summary just like information from any other
760 Text between %( and %) will be highlighted with `gnus-mouse-face'
761 when the mouse point is placed inside the area. There can only be one
764 The %U (status), %R (replied) and %z (zcore) specs have to be handled
765 with care. For reasons of efficiency, Gnus will compute what column
766 these characters will end up in, and \"hard-code\" that. This means that
767 it is illegal to have these specs after a variable-length spec. Well,
768 you might not be arrested, but your summary buffer will look strange,
771 The smart choice is to have these specs as for to the left as
774 This restriction may disappear in later versions of Gnus.")
